Jock itch: Jock itch is a groin eruption usually caused by the combination of recurrent friction and a yeast infection. It is characterized by large region or red rash which may get worse if simple cortisone cream or ointment is applied. Treatment consists of avoidance of tight underwear and application of an antiyeast ointment. This can be combined with cortisone such as in mycolog to curtail itching.
